For this week's sync: all Marlowe schema changes use the four-phase flow — expand, dual-write, backfill, contract. Each phase ships as its own deploy. The backfill worker throttles to 2k rows/sec and checkpoints to the `mig_progress` table, so interrupted runs resume cleanly. Rollback is safe at any phase before contract; after contract, restore from the Delacourt snapshot instead. Confirm the migration gate dashboard is green before advancing phases. The current migration's trace token is recorded below.

session token of tajef-bageg = htk21_5d90d574934f3ccae6437

Hi on-call,

As of this sprint, responsibility for migrating the Cartwheel service to the Fennelforge hermetic build system is changing hands. The migration is mid-flight: toolchain pinning is complete, but network-fetching steps in the asset pipeline still break sandboxed builds. If a build fails on-call tonight, check the sandbox violation log before rolling back, and document any manual fetches you permit. Going forward, all migration questions, exceptions, and sign-offs route to the new owner listed below.

account owner for bawip-tahag: Raleth Quenok

## Configuration

Pufferbox squeezes telemetry payloads before they leave the agent, so support folks mostly just tune two knobs: `PUFFER_CODEC` (stick with `zstd` unless a customer's proxy chokes on it) and `PUFFER_BATCH_KB`, which caps batch size pre-compression. Compressed batches are also signed so the Mallow ingest tier can reject tampered uploads, and the signing secret sits on the very next line.

vault entry, yahif-yajep: COURIER_KEY29=b802bdf8034096b65a51c6ba5abe2